Allot Ltd is an Israel-based company engaged primarily in the software solutions for the communication sector. The Company is a provider of security solutions and network intelligence solutions for mobile, fixed and cloud service providers as well as enterprises worldwide. The Company's solutions are deployed globally for network-based security, including mobile security, distributed denial of service (DDoS) protection and Internet of Things (IoT) security, network and application analytics, traffic control and shaping, and more. The Company delivers a unified security service for individual consumers and small and medium-sized businesses (SMBs), at home, at work and on the go, with the Allot Secure product family.

How do we generate the risk management score of Allot Ltd?

To assess the risk management score of Allot Ltd, we examine multiple key indicators related to returns, risk, volatility, and liquidity.
The highest and lowest daily returns reflect the potential size of gains and losses, while the Sharpe ratio measures risk-adjusted return performance. On the risk side, we analyse maximum drawdown and the return-to-drawdown ratio to identify extreme loss scenarios. Skewness helps assess the distribution of returns and whether performance may be biased. Volatility indicators—such as realised volatility and standardised true range—reveal price fluctuations. Downside risk-adjusted returns provide insight into potential losses and gains. Lastly, liquidity metrics like average turnover rate and turnover deviation indicate how actively the stock is traded.
These indicators together provide a multi-dimensional understanding of Allot Ltd’s risk-return profile, serving as core factors of the risk management score. A higher score indicates lower risk on the side of Allot Ltd.
